Transaction 3eb90cbbd30f216651a0894d2f36423e4045532cf5c228a7becd38282e5cf995
1 Input
1 Output
-
3eb90cbbd30f216651a0894d2f36423e4045532cf5c228a7becd38282e5cf995:0
- value
- 1377674
- script pubkey
- OP_0 OP_PUSHBYTES_20 05db5769582660d3d4e5c7ea365359dae25d9a0c
- address
- bc1qqhd4w62cyesd8489cl4rv56emt39mxsv4wm0wt